X-Authentication-Warning: delorie.com: mail set sender to geda-user-bounces using -f X-Recipient: geda-user AT delorie DOT com X-TCPREMOTEIP: 173.48.170.224 X-Authenticated-UID: jpd AT noqsi DOT com From: John Doty Content-Type: multipart/alternative; boundary="Apple-Mail=_3B663CD4-F04C-4FDA-9382-57DBA3E83C09" Mime-Version: 1.0 (Mac OS X Mail 10.3 \(3273\)) Subject: Re: [geda-user] Refdes bug or Master Attribute Document on the Wiki needs update. Date: Wed, 30 Jan 2019 13:00:10 -0500 References: <9ed059c0-f3c5-1482-169b-f8f1119f3208 AT fastmail DOT com> To: geda-user AT delorie DOT com In-Reply-To: Message-Id: <39F95153-164B-4676-9321-D0AB679E7F19@noqsi.com> X-Mailer: Apple Mail (2.3273) Reply-To: geda-user AT delorie DOT com Errors-To: nobody AT delorie DOT com X-Mailing-List: geda-user AT delorie DOT com X-Unsubscribes-To: listserv AT delorie DOT com Precedence: bulk --Apple-Mail=_3B663CD4-F04C-4FDA-9382-57DBA3E83C09 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=utf-8 > On Jan 30, 2019, at 12:36 PM, gedau AT igor2 DOT repo DOT hu wrote: >=20 > pcb and/or gsch2pcb and/or the pcb backend (gnetlist) may have traces = of=20 > the suffixing assumption from some age when someone thought it would = be a=20 > good idea to have it in gEDA too. (pcb-rnd doesn't have a special case = for=20 > lower case last letter of refdes - if some old corner of the code has = it,=20 > it's a bug that I'd fix when reported). But that should be a choice, defined by the scripting for a particular = flow, not in the core code. There aren=E2=80=99t just these two = mechanisms, either. Allegro, for example, has a much more elaborate = mechanism that keeps track of the symmetries within slots (which input = to the NAND you use doesn=E2=80=99t matter), as well as the symmetries = between slots (which slot your use doesn=E2=80=99t matter). John Doty Noqsi Aerospace, Ltd. jpd AT noqsi DOT com --Apple-Mail=_3B663CD4-F04C-4FDA-9382-57DBA3E83C09 Content-Transfer-Encoding: quoted-printable Content-Type: text/html; charset=utf-8
On Jan 30, 2019, at 12:36 PM, gedau AT igor2 DOT repo DOT hu = wrote:

pcb and/or gsch2pcb and/or the = pcb backend (gnetlist) may have traces of 
the suffixing assumption from some age when = someone thought it would be a 
good idea to have it in gEDA too. (pcb-rnd = doesn't have a special case for 
lower case last letter of refdes - if some old = corner of the code has it, 
it's a bug that I'd fix when = reported).

But that should be a choice, defined by the = scripting for a particular flow, not in the core code. There aren=E2=80=99= t just these two mechanisms, either. Allegro, for example, has a much = more elaborate mechanism that keeps track of the symmetries within slots = (which input to the NAND you use doesn=E2=80=99t matter), as well as the = symmetries between slots (which slot your use doesn=E2=80=99t = matter).

John Doty    =           Noqsi = Aerospace, Ltd.

jpd AT noqsi DOT com




= --Apple-Mail=_3B663CD4-F04C-4FDA-9382-57DBA3E83C09--